Keto Butter Swim Biscuits Recipe

Keto Butter Swim Biscuits

(Makes 9 biscuits)

Ingredients

Dry Mix:

2 cups almond flour (super fine)

1 tbsp baking powder

½ tsp salt

Wet Mix:

2 large eggs

1 cup unsweetened almond milk (or coconut milk)

1 tsp apple cider vinegar (optional, for extra fluffiness)

Butter Layer:

½ c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ted

Instructions
1️⃣ Preheat Oven & Prep Pan

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).

Pour melted butter into an 8×8-inch baking dish.

2️⃣ Mix Dry Ingredients

In a medium bowl, whisk together almond flour, baking powder, and salt.

3️⃣ Mix Wet Ingredients

In another bowl, whisk eggs, almond milk, and apple cider vinegar until combined.

4️⃣ Combine Batter

Pour wet mixture into dry mixture and stir until fully combined into a thick batter.

5️⃣ Assemble & Bake

Pour biscuit batter over the melted butter in the baking dish (do not stir).

Smooth the top and score into 9 equal sections with a knife.

Bake for 25–30 minutes until golden brown and set.

6️⃣ Serve

Let cool slightly before cutting. Serve warm with keto-friendly butter, sugar-free jam, or gravy.

💡 Macros (per biscuit — approx)

Carbs: ~3g net

Fat: ~18g

Protein: ~6g

Calories: ~200
